INCAE Business School

INCAE Business School

Region: Americas

Country: Costa Rica

City: La Garita

ABOUT INCAE Business School

As the best business school in Latin America, INCAE has promoted the progress of Latin American society, through the training of talent from regional leaders through top management programs.

With over 50 years of experience, INCAE is more than just a business school. Faithful to its mission, the school supports the development of the region through 1) the development of Latin American leaders with a global perspective and 2) the creation of knowledge applied and developed by its research centers, particularly in the areas of competitivity and sustainability, entrepreneurship and women’s leadership.